Macaroni Bake with Ham and Peppers

Don't let the long list of ingredients scare you! This recipe is easy and tasty, great for a family sized meal or if you want leftovers.

1 lb elbow macaroni
1 Tbsp olive oil
1 Tbsp minced garlic
1 red bell pepper
1 (14.5 oz) can chopped tomatoes
9 oz smoked ham, diced
3 Tbsp chicken stock
2 tsp dried oregano
1 Cup bread crumbs
3 Tbsp grated parmesean
2 Tbsp butter, melted
2 Cups spaghetti sauce

Preheat oven to 400. Cook macaroni noodles as directed and drain.

Meanwhile, heat oil in a saucepan. Add garlic and red bell pepper and cook for about 5 minutes until softened. Add the tomatoes, ham, chicken stock and oregano and simmer for about 3 minutes. Add all to the macaroni, stir, and season with salt and pepper.

Pour spaghetti sauce into a large baking dish and spread evenly. Add the macaroni mixture to the top of the sauce. Mix the bread crumbs, parmesean and butter and sprinkly on top.

Place on a baking sheet and bake for about 15-20 minutes or until golden brown and bubbly.
